Как стать автором
Обновить
4
0.4

Пользователь

Отправить сообщение

Отсутствие полностью бесплатных отеч. почтовых клиентов говорит о том что все они написаны исключительнор ради заработка на импортозамещении. А в него (в И-замещение) всё-таки иной смысл (и цель) вкладываются (властями и обществом). Осознание этого простого факта отключает интерес к теме, точнее обостряет интерес к СПО.

Поэтому для МСБ остается "Тундра", ThunderBird. Не глючит, свободен, настраивается под любые корп. требования(особенно есть знать JavaScript). шифрование из коробки по любым алгоритмам, тысячи расширений, позволяющие на базе простой автоматизации префиксов/суффиксов тем, контента, вставки кнопок, пометок, ссылок итд легко имитировать EDM, CRM, телефонию (с набором номера по клику в Адресной книге) итд. Для неравнодушного айтишника - широкое и благодарное поле деятельности.

Включить в базу сравнения константное значение (3060) с долей в смете 50%+ это пять. Но в целом слив Зеонов засчитан.

Собирать ПК на Xeon в 2024 году нужно хотя бы для того чтобы было меньше электронного мусора. Навыки сборки, прошивки BIOS (в т.ч. с программатором) из компонентов которые не жалко ("процессор по цене кулера, RAM по цене иыши") - сами по себе бесценны, особенно если делать это неспешно и с детьми. Лучшей профориентации не придумать. Вряд ли стоит давать детям в руки нежные 12-14-е серии свежих камней, цена ошибки слишком высока.

На Зионы обычно ставят GPU попроще и в бюджете до 20 тыс. руб. В этом случае экономия от того варианта, что вам навяжут в офлайн-магазине будет "в 2 раза", не заметить которую в наше время решительно невозможно.

Leon не стареет, это единственный в мире товар, который за 12 лет потерял в цене только букву ($ сменился рублем, а число осталось прежним). Пользуйтесь моментом, такого в истории человечества больше не будет.

Скорость слияния в свободном и бесплатном OpenOffice|LibreOffice на похожих документах достигает 0,03 сек/договор. При этом не требуется программирования вовсе, суммы и даты прописью - из коробки, Стили, форматирование - готовые, из других, уже имеющихся документов, и абсолютно всё работает локально. На выбор - формирование одного или тысяч файлов россыпью, в любом из 20-ти популярных форматов, включая PDF c элементами формы (списки, флажки) для ручного дозаполнения.

Для соблюдения Закона о ПД можно просто создать криптоконтейнер VeraCrypt в котором без установки распаковать весь Portable LibreOffice (не требует установки и прав админа) и не светить паспортными данными вообще нигде. После отмонтирования контейнера на ПК не будет никаких следов ПД, кроме выходных PDF/DOCX/ODT-файлов (вот с ними - да, надо быть аккуратнее).

Единственное, в чем может потребоваться помощь айтишника - это подсказать что 1С (все ПД лежат там) злонамеренно ограничивает число кодировок при экспорте таблиц (Сохранить как) и что cp1251 (Win) легко заменяется на utf-8 (Unicode) в LibreOffice.

Конечно же, айтишнику есть что улучшить даже в этой схеме. Например, готовый "слиянием" PDF может содержать не только элементы управления, но и код, который будет его обрабатывать. Это или JavaScript (мехнизм PDF), или StarBasic/Python/Java/JavaScript, внедренный внутрь PDF по установке галочки "гибридный" PDF. По сути вы получаете PDF-контейнер, в котором находится "заряженный" макросами ODT (OpenDocumentFormat), и он может бесконечно перезаполняться слиянием многократно (при открытии в OpenOffice|LibreOffice), но останется "обычным" PDF для всех остальных, кому это не нужно. Ничего подобного ни один платный "офис" и другие свободные пакеты пока не умеют и еще очень долго не смогут.

Противопоставлять "эффективность" и KPI не всегда правильно.

Например, еще недавно лучшим способом максимизации дохода от действующего бизнеса был "разогрев" компании (рост нематериальных активов) для выхода на IPO и продажи "пузыря", забив на жизненный цикл продукта и тектонику конкуренции. И здесь KPI-и, заточенные именно на повышение стоимости фирмы, были эффективными (уж точно лучше чем пустые призывы и разбрасывание денег с вертолета/на корпоративе).

Можно, но ценой ~4-кратного замедления. Помимо скорости, МИ выглядит красиво в Блокноте, а также при df.to_excel() в эл. таблице дает опр. "легкость".

Некоторые аналитики не любят МИ и даже обычные группировки они делают с as_index=False, но это от лени.
Единственное место где МИ реально мешает - это в столбцах. Там он непомерно усложняет обращение к столбцам и приводит к тому что таблица становится слишком широкой даже для огромного монитора.

Просто чудесный научпоп и Мурзилка анти-еретика. Прочел на одном дыхании, заставлю прочесть ещё сотню других. Очень понравилось, противоречий и нелогичности не увидел. Не ядерщик, но физику не прогуливал, а главное - вырос среди биоэнергетической аномалии (семейной, географической), в которой изначально видел нестыковки всего со всем и "замыкания" на себя.

Даже несмотря на безумное кол-во опечаток - статья очень понравилась. Минусующие, возможно, слишком авторитарны, чтобы признать сабж действенным инструментом. Среди IT-спецов авторитаризм распространен больше чем в других отраслях, в силу безропотной исполнительности наших средств труда (хард, софт) при почти полном отсутствии "трущихся частей" (людей). Впрочем, и применений сабжа в IT, кмк, меньше: слишком многое в IT формализовано, стандартизировано, а такие средства как фреймворки - обусловливают правильный путь едва ли не сразу. Проблема первоначального выбора (стека, фреймворка, стандарта связи, протокола итд) - не для сабжа, и статья в этом убеждает.

Красивого на Tk вообще ничего не встречал. Очень сильно продвинулись за последнее время web-инструменты (streamlit, gradio итд) и консольные утилиты для имитации GUI.

Пункты 2 и 9 "Итогов" - одинаковы. Для пущей доказательности :-)

Немного жаль что налогоплательщик проиграл. Шансы выиграть были, не хватило малого:

  • надо было держать штатных неск. человек. Они бы сильно "торчали" со своими договорами, табелями и должн. инструкциями в материалах дела. Верховный суд как раз такие сложные случаи берет;

  • надо было имитировать правдоподобно. ФНС знает что настоящие самозанятые - разгильдяи через одного. А тут идеальная картина. Не удивлюсь если налог НПД платился в один день.

  • надо было сторонний заработок и занятия в парке.

Очень интересный проект, спасибо. Трассировка лучей в графиках, опции функций - так держать! Jupyter наше все, но бесплатный W. с Raspberry Pi когда-то зашел и подтолкнул к изучению интерактивных вычислений. А концепт справочных "знаний" из W. до сих пор вызывает здоровую зависть, хоть и легко повторим в Python-среде. Например, я оцифровал бумажный совковый "Справочник по физике и технике" (~400 таблиц), написал десятки UDF c русскими именами и теперь перевожу, к примеру, тн в м3 в Pandas вот так:

df.вес.apply(тн_в_м3, что=df.вещество)

Конечно же при наборе работает автодополнение, подсказка синтаксиса и отображение в окне документации ф-ии на русском языке, понятном инженерам и экономистам. Для перевода 1 тыс. позиций из тн в м3 нужно нажать ~10 клавиш, на что уходит ~20 секунд. На получение "учетной" себестоимости этих материалов в руб. и перевод суммы в USD по курсу ЦБ - еще столько же (еще две цепные UDF-функции без параметров). Это совершенно иное качество и ощущение от работы. Мозг "впивается" в полученный результат, а не просит кофеина для разгрузки при классическом Excel/PBI-пути.

В условиях горного похода ТД с проточным нагревом воды газовой горелкой - эффективен и дарит незабываемый комфорт. Дамы так просто в восторге. Альтернатива летом - это горное озеро с t = 9C и водой без солей, в которой не растворяется ни одно мыло, не смывается ни один масс-маркет шампунь (пену просто стирают с себя полотенцем).

Предложения по карлсонам в статье немного спорные и отчасти невыполнимые:

  • Невозможно поставить "все на вдув", т.к. вентилятор БП всегда дует через БП - наружу.

  • Делать на выдув передний корпусный вместо классического заднего - плохо: где-то точно станет горячее: диски, зона VRM или RAM, зона M.2-устр-в. Это не то что нужно для здоровья ПК.

Но сама идея прикрыть нетканкой вентили на вдув - здравая. Только получается что это всего два: передний и боковой корпусные вентили, торчащие напоказ. Как это сделать красиво - вопрос большого или маленького "колхозинга".

В большинстве работающих виденных ПК, серверов и промоборудования видел внутри прибором только пониженное давление, а не повышенное. Если создавать повышенное - нужен чистый воздух, а его-то взять негде.

Девальвировать науку можно только научными методами, анекдоты к их числу не относятся.

108 человек были выбраны по настоящему случайно, проверена стат-гипотеза об этом, посчитаны вероятности.

Дальше за ними следили 7 (семь) лет, а результаты подвергли глубокому стат-анализу, на который способны немногие, но который могут повторить все, окончившие даже гуманитарный вуз с вышматом/тервером/терстатом.

Одним словом, берегите науку. Анекдоты как вид субкультуры тоже берегите, жанр вымирает.

Блокноты просто разбивают код-лапшу на отдельные ячейки. В ад ее превращает нечто другое: ячейки "на попробовать". Их легко избежать.

Отличная работа! Однозначно посыл к более смелому фич-инжинирингу и безумным джойнам данных всего со всем.

Оценки времени на отбор в очередной раз дают повод для ~грусти~ upgrade ПК аналитиков, но это как раз то самое немногое, на что можно и нужно влиять.

В отличие от VBA, не меняющегося с 1995 г., та же 1С, ее маркетологи, сделали всё (новыми версиями платформ и чехардой конфигураций), чтобы доморщенных автоматизаторов свести в 0, и чтобы "в одно лицо" невозможно было сделать ни один весомый IT-проект в ней. Без чисел нехорошо, поэтому вот: сколько должно быть таблиц в БД учетной системы? 100? 1000? А не хотели 10000, как в УПП?! Вы можете представить DBA-человека c пониманием этой схемы данных?

VBA хоронят каждый год примерно с 2000-х. Разработчиков на VBA несколько десятков миллионов, и через 20 лет их будет столько же. А вот что будет с 1С - посмотрим. Их монопольное положение и мышление - пагубно. И в конечном итоге приведет к появлению простого и мощного конкурента, который свергнет лидера. Лимит усложнения систем от 1С исчерпан. "Всё реализовать внутри 1С" не вышло ни у кого, пройдите по заводам. Говорю об этом с горечью, надежды в эпоху 7.7 и первых 8-к были.

Еще лучше - один ReadOnly-файл "надстройки" *.xlam, расшаренный по сети LAN и подключенный на всех Excel/Calc у пользователей. Это по сути сетевая "корпоративная" библиотека макросов, в которой может быть автоматизировано большое число бизнес-процессов, не привлекая внимания СБ, IT и санитаров.

VBA-разработчики неспешно правят *.xlam (напрямую или правят свой и обновляют файл с заменой и восст. реквизита ReadOnly), а другие пользователи - незаметно для себя читают его при каждом открытии Excel/Calc. Это CI/СD.
Еще правильнее развернуть локальный Gitlab и собирать *.xlam из *.bas-файлов (исходных кодов) с автотестами.

Поясню за OpenOffice|LibreOffice Calc: сам он не поддерживает механизм "надстроек", но прекрасно читает макросы из XLAM-файлов (ведь это обычные xlsm-файлы с другим расширением). Совместимость VBA-кода для Calc - высокая, ~80%.

Если при работе макрорекордера не суетиться и избегать записи неподдерживаемых в Calc VBA-методов - делать кросс-офисные макроcы можно с прежней скоростью: очень быстро. По сравнению с классической разработкой - мгновенно.

Верно, VBA был бы проще. Если в качестве БД используется Excel - чаще всего VBA оптимален и достаточен.
Но Python+Pandas добавляют ту самую кондовость при работе с данными, которой не хватает в случае если эти данные снаружи и постоянно растут вширь и в длину. Несколько замечаний все же выдам.

  1. В Pandas нет псевдонимов полей, но прекрасно работают русские имена колонок, к которым легко обращаться вот так:
    df.цена = (df.сумма / df.колво).fillna('') Срезы в Python прекрасны, но обилие [ ] [ ] скобок ухудшает понимание кода. При работе в JupyterLab (это самая удобная IDE/среда для подобных проектов и вообще для "анализа) - работает авто-дополнение по нажатию Tab, не надо имена полей набирать руками. Конечно, имена полей д.б. без пробелов, из спецсимволов только _, регистр - нижний. Это простое правило сделает таблицы ближе к людям.

  2. Стайлер в Pandas слабоват (а openpyxl сложен), поэтому форматирование Excel/Calc (XLSX/ODS-файлов) до идеала лучше делать на VBA, код для которого проще Записать (макро-рекордером в Excel), чем Написать. Вы будете приятно удивлены тем фактом что 90% записанного в Excel кода на VBA сработает автоматически и в свободном, бесплатном LibreOffice Calc (при открытии в нем XLS/XLSM/XLSB-файла). Заметьте, записывать надо в Excel, т.к. встроенный макрорекордер в Calc слаб и пишет в "свой" диалект Basic, способен перехватить лишь ~50% команд пользователя через т.н. Dispatcher. В Calc теперь есть все функции листа Excel на том же русском языке, включая новые-модные (заимствованные, к слову, из Pandas). VBA-код для beauty-форматирования при открытии файла можно запускать автоматически. Т.к. он специфичен для каждого типа документа - в первых строках макроса надо определить что именно открыто. Делайте это просто, по содержимому специфических ячеек: If [C3].Value="position" Then Сall Спека Так вы вызовете нужный "форматирующий" макрос.

  3. Использование эл. таблиц позволяет эффективно нагрузить работой коллег. Будучи причастными к результату - они гораздо охотнее будут им пользоваться (коллаборация вообще страшная штука). Пока вы в IDE пишете код - люди с опытом в Excel/Calc нарисуют за вас в ячейках листа полноценный интерфейс, пошаговые "визарды", сделают валидацию на Данные-Проверка и Усл. форматировании, раскрасят как им нра и вообще будут счастливы.

use - да, используй (утвердительная формулировка)
skip - нет, не используй (отрицательная формулировка)

Круто! И все же не хватает ясности: насколько удалось улучшить модель рельефа по сравнению с SRTM2/3? Если выражаться просто, то SRTM (и все общедоступные цифровые карты) - сейчас уступает в детализации рельефа старому Генштабу 1:50000 (сплошные горизонтали через 10 метров) в разы: не видно 70% мелких оврагов, ручьев, промоин, причем даже на незалесенных плато (Лаго-Наки итд). Это сильно девальвирует ценность всех цифровых карт для туристов, спортсменов, спасателей, поскольку рельеф в горах - на втором месте по важности для выживания после троп (по их же статистике до 10% походов и до 80% спасработ происходят на бестропье, на склонах где из ориентиров есть только рельеф и ничего больше).

1
23 ...

Информация

В рейтинге
2 040-й
Зарегистрирован
Активность